Russian Energy Minister Alexander Novak and Greek Energy Minister Panayotis Skurletis have discussed issues of bilateral cooperation and the Turkish Stream project during a telephone conversation.
"The sides have confirmed the feasibility of developing new gas transport infrastructure on the territory of Greece for Russian natural gas supplies to European consumers. They also discussed the schedule of gas pipeline construction signed at the St. Petersburg International Economic Forum and the progress of implementing the memorandum of cooperation in construction and operation of the gas pipeline in Greece.
Novak and Skurletis agreed to continue an intensive dialogue, including in the format of a special Russian-Greek working group for energy that has been established, Interfax reports.
